Package: initscripts
Version: 2.88dsf-59.3+devuan2
Severity: normal

On Debian initscripts, between 2.88dsf-59 and 2.88dsf-59.9 as been added, as alternative to sysv-rc/file-rc, dependancy against openrc.

I think openrc by default uses /etc/init.d scripts

Is there a reason not to do so in Devuan?
